Batch file 如何在启动webdriver后创建批处理文件以执行量角器配置文件

Batch file 如何在启动webdriver后创建批处理文件以执行量角器配置文件,batch-file,selenium-webdriver,protractor,Batch File,Selenium Webdriver,Protractor,我试图创建一个批处理文件,在更新和启动webdriver之后,执行我的量角器config.js文件。我面临以下问题 I tried with below batch code to update and start the webdriver, But after the webdriver update the cmd prompt closed without starting the webdriver. @echo on webdriver-manager update webdriv

我试图创建一个批处理文件,在更新和启动webdriver之后,执行我的量角器config.js文件。我面临以下问题

I tried with below batch code to update and start the webdriver,
But after the webdriver update the cmd prompt closed without starting the webdriver.

@echo on
webdriver-manager update
webdriver-manager start
protractor config.js
pause

谁能帮我创建一个批处理文件来启动webdriver并执行量角器配置文件。

如果
webdriver manager
是批处理文件或
.cmd
文件,请使用
CALL
命令执行并返回。否则,您将启动新的批处理文件,它将永远不会返回到您的批处理文件

call webdriver-manager update

等。

从批处理运行,而不是调用
webdriver manager start
只需从量角器配置文件运行独立的selenium服务器

webdriver-manager update --versions.standalone=3.4.0
protractor config.js
在配置文件中

seleniumServerJar: 'node_modules/protractor/node_modules/webdriver-manager/selenium/selenium-server-standalone-3.4.0.jar',

你好,谢谢你的评论。在.bat文件中使用上述命令。只有更新发生,并且它开始执行配置文件而不启动webdriver。获取的错误消息为错误:ECONREFUNCE connect ECONREFUNCE。